The God Delusion? – Dr. Marc Surtees Refutes Richard Dawkins

Share it with your friends Like

Thanks! Share it with your friends!

Close

Challenging Dawkins. Marc’s PhD is in zoology in this 5 part talk he responds to Richard’s arguments from chapter 4 of The God Delusion.

Presented at http://EdinburghCreationGroup.org